OBJECTIVE: To establish a murine model of influenza pneumonia and to determine whether there is a specific intestinal pathological injury during the course of respiratory influenza virus infection and to explore its application in the study of “lung and large intestine phase.” Methods: 48 BALB / c mice were randomly divided into normal group and model group. The model group was given intraperitoneal injection of 25μL 50LD50 virus to establish the pneumonia model of influenza virus infection in mice. The model mice were harvested at 0, 3, 5 and 6 days after infection. The pathological results of lung and colon, small intestine, heart, kidney and liver were detected by HE staining. Serum levels of serum urea nitrogen (BUN), alanine aminotransferase (ALT) and aspartate aminotransferase (AST) were measured by blood biochemistry.
